I applied online. I interviewed at Airbus (Stevenage, England)
Interview
Applied online --> Online reasoning tests --> Invitation to assessment centre
Assessment centre consisted of background briefing, Group exercise (simple), business scenario, graduate insight where current graduate answered any questions you had and finally interview.

I applied online. The process took 2 months. I interviewed at Airbus (Friedrichshafen)
Interview
Introduction of participants and their educational and professional background.
Introduction of the department and their products, explanation of the procedure how an experiment idea of a PI becomes a real experiment. Afterwards tour of the labs.
